      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hello,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t; Developer access key is required by a user to create objects (programs, data dictionary objects etc.) in SAP. This can be obtained from OSS against a user name and gets into table DEVACCESS.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Object access key is required for modifying standard objects delivered by SAP. This can be tracked by transactions SPAU or SPAD and needs to be looked into during upgrade. With source code plug-in technology, you can create explicit or implicit enhancements without Object access key in ERP 6.0.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Venu&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
